01What is Monolithos?
Monolithos is a local-first, Markdown-native Memory OS: a workstation where memory, AI tasks, writing, presentation, audio, capture, projects, and private boundaries share one user-owned vault.

05Is my vault used for model training?
No. Your vault remains on your device. Monolithos servers route only the AI calls you choose to make.
06What happens if I cancel?
Your plain Markdown and YAML files remain on your disk and stay readable without Monolithos.
07Can I open an existing Obsidian vault?
Yes. There is no migration or import: both apps can work with the same Markdown files.

10What works offline?
Vault access, editing, and local capabilities remain local. Minutes transcription runs on-device. Calls to cloud-hosted frontier models require a network connection.
11Which AI models does Monolithos use?
A frontier constellation with Auto routing. The website deliberately avoids pinning model versions so the product can route current suitable capacity.
12Does Minutes upload my recordings?
No. Audio and raw transcripts remain on-device; only structured text you approve can touch cloud AI.
13What is the Private Domain?
A folder boundary you designate. Cloud AI recall, chat, and crystallization cannot cross it.
14How do Projects prevent context leakage?
Each project binds selected sources, and long tasks snapshot that boundary when they launch.
15Where do generated images go?
Facet persists generated assets into your vault and records their provenance, so the library can find them again after restart.
